graph the function ( y = 2^{x - 4}-5 ) using the given table of values and following the instructions below.
equation of asymptote:
( y=)
next
Step1: Recall the general form of an exponential function
The general form of an exponential function is \(y = a\cdot b^{x - h}+k\). For the function \(y = 2^{x - 4}-5\), where \(a = 1\), \(b = 2\), \(h = 4\), and \(k=-5\).
Step2: Determine the horizontal asymptote
For an exponential function of the form \(y=a\cdot b^{x - h}+k\), the horizontal asymptote is given by the equation \(y = k\).
